Orlando in June

Orlando in June is historically a poor month for sun: only 7% of days clear across 8 years (n=240, avg high 88°F). March is the clearest month for Orlando historically. Historical average, not a forecast.

What you are reading: 8-year historical averages from the ERA5 reanalysis, not a forecast. A month that is historically 90% clear can still be overcast on your specific trip. Sunshine & warmth in June

A second measure using actual sunshine hours (ERA5 sunshine_duration), not the daily weather code. A Lowcountry day with 12 hours of sun and a 25-minute afternoon storm is counted below as a warm, sunny day — because it was. How we define this.

Sunshine-based metrics for Orlando in June. Primary: % of days ≥ 72°F with > 6 h of sunshine.
Period Warm & sunny (≥72°F, >6 h sun) Sample (n)
Early June
1st–15th
88% n=120
Late June
16th–end
92% n=120
Full month average 90% n=240
11.8 h median sunshine per day 82% of days exceed 8 h sunshine 75% of days see ≥ 1 mm rain — rain is not hidden
Comparison (old vs new): WMO-code “clear” bar: 7%. Sunshine-based “warm & sunny”: 90%. The 83-point gap is from brief afternoon convective storms that stamp the whole day as “rain” in the WMO code but leave the bulk of the sunshine untouched.

Every month in Orlando

Compare across all months with data. Numbers are historical clear-sky %.

Historical clear-sky % for Orlando, all months, ERA5 2018–2025.
Month % Clear Sample (n)
January 20% n=248 All destinations →
February 33% n=226 All destinations →
March 45% n=248 All destinations →
April 44% n=240 All destinations →
May 30% n=248 All destinations →
June ← this page 7% n=240 All destinations →
July 2% n=248 All destinations →
August 3% n=248 All destinations →
September 10% n=240 All destinations →
October 30% n=248 All destinations →
November 32% n=240 All destinations →
December 26% n=248 All destinations →

All percentages are historical averages from the ERA5 reanalysis via Open-Meteo, 8 full years (2018–2025). “Clear” means avg high ≥ 72 °F, precipitation < 1 mm, and a non-precipitation weather code.
